Question

Which of the following are applicable to the term ‘Carnival’?
A. It became important through the work of the Russian theorist Mikhail Bakhtin.
B. It means the way in which popular humour subverts official authority in classical, medieval and renaissance texts and culture.
C. It overturns the established hierarchy and sets up a popular and democratic counterculture.
D. It brings out the serious elements in literature.
E. It is used as a critical tool for interpretation of poetry.
Choose the correct answer from the options given below:

A.

A, B and C only

B.

A and B only

C.

B and C only

D.

A and C only

Correct option is A

The correct answer is (a) A, B, and C only. The term "carnival" became important through the work of the Russian theorist Mikhail Bakhtin, who used it to describe a literary mode that subverts and liberates the assumptions of the dominant style or atmosphere through humor and chaos. Bakhtin argued that the carnivalesque is a powerful force for social change, as it allows people to temporarily overthrow the established hierarchy and create a more egalitarian and democratic society.
Carnivalesque elements can be found in many classical, medieval, and Renaissance texts and culture, as well as in modern literature and popular culture. Some examples of carnivalesque elements include:
 Grotesque and bodily imagery
 Over-the-top physical comedy
 Inversion of social roles
 Burlesque and satire
 Parody and blasphemy
